Picking Out the Right Outdoor Sofa



When selecting outdoor furniture sofas, construction types are key. Aluminium frames are easy to move and resist rust, making them long-lasting. Wooden frames, such as eucalyptus, offer a more rustic aesthetic and age well over time.



Rattan-look designs, usually made from woven polymer, combine durability and comfort. Seat pads should be quick-drying, with machine-washable covers for cleaning ease. Fabrics that offer UV protection help retain colour vibrancy through the seasons.

Space-Saving Outdoor Sofas



For limited outdoor areas, consider two-seaters that offer a comfortable place to sit without cluttering the space. Hidden storage beneath seats can be used to store cushions, throws, or covers.



Stackable versions are convenient for winter when season changes. Opting for natural colours helps maintain a spacious feel in small areas.
